The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1997 Jeanneau/Lagoon 35CCC is a distinctive catamaran that offers a blend of performance and comfort. Here are some of the p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Spacious Layout: The 35CCC features a roomy interior and deck space typical of catamarans, providing comfortable accommodations for cruising or living aboard.
Stable and Comfortable Ride: Its twin-hull design offers excellent stability, reducing heel and making for a smoother sailing experience, especially in choppy conditions.
Good Performance: For a cruising catamaran of its size and era, the Lagoon 35CCC provides respectable sailing performance, balancing speed and handling.
Durable Construction: Built by Jeanneau/Lagoon, known for quality craftsmanship, the 35CCC has robust construction that can withstand extended cruising.
Versatile Use: Suitable for coastal cruising, weekend getaways, and longer passages, making it a flexible choice for sailors.
Cons
Older Design: Being a model from 1997, some design elements and onboard systems may be dated compared to more modern catamarans.
Maintenance Needs: As with any older boat, upkeep can be more intensive, with potential for wear in rigging, sails, and mechanical systems requiring attention.
Limited Dealer Support: Since it’s an older model, finding specific replacement parts or specialized service may be more challenging.
Performance Trade-offs: While stable and comfortable, it may not match the speed or agility of newer or more performance-oriented catamarans.
Space Efficiency: Though spacious, the 35CCC’s layout may not maximize interior volume as efficiently as some newer designs with more contemporary hull shapes.
